Ninpocho Chronicles is a fantasy-ish setting storyline, set in an alternate universe World of Ninjas, where the Naruto and Boruto series take place. This means that none of the canon characters exists, or existed here.

Each ninja starts from the bottom and start their training as an Academy Student. From there they develop abilities akin to that of demigods as they grow in age and experience.

Along the way they gain new friends (or enemies), take on jobs and complete contracts and missions for their respective villages where their training and skill will be tested to their limits.

The sky is the limit as the blank page you see before you can be filled with countless of adventures with your character in the game.

This is Ninpocho Chronicles.

Despite how hard Maikeru tried to move forward, to forge new paths for his life, he consistently found himself backtracking to his old ways. He was an accomplished swordsman, with the aid of his Sharingan he would genuinely, without bias, say he was one of the most skilled in the cloud village. Well, perhaps a slight amount of bias. Regardless, with everything that had happened to him lately, between the mark of the king and the cursed seal, he found himself using his bladeless and less. It didn’t help that the sword he had spent hours crafting and forging to be perfect for him was a useless husk leaning against his bedroom wall, the spirit of it now residing inside of his own body.

Still, there was nothing wrong with gaining new power, even if it wasn’t in the way he had envisioned. For whatever reason he found himself leaning back on genjutsu and ninjutsu, like he had when he was still the academy, back when he had fought the legendary fire-tamer Saitou Reicheru, and he had been known as Joker. There was a small smile that came to his face as he remembered that night before it quickly faded as new memories overtook it. With a sigh, he picked up his satchel and walked towards the door of his fifth floor home, leaving the husk of Kusanagi behind. It was time for something new, or well, old depending on how you looked at it.

The cool spring air bit against his face as he locked the door behind him, taking a moment to enjoy the slight warmth as he stepped onto the railing outside of his domicile. Inhaling deeply, he leaped forward, going from rooftop to rooftop towards his destination. The Coliseum was where he was headed today, where an opponent would be waiting for him already. He had prearranged this little bout days ago, eager to test what these new boons he had received had given him.

When he arrived his opponent was already waiting for him, a blue-haired Chuunin from the main branch whom he had met at the hospital. Perhaps using his patient as a potential test subject for his own growth was unethical, but, he wasn’t really concerned with that as this moment. Instead, he simply slipped out of his trench coat, letting the heavy garment fall to the ground as he prepared himself.

“Oi, doc.” The girl called out, a bit too cheerful for how early in the morning it was. “You sure you wanna go through with this? I know you medics probably don’t spend too much time on combat training.”

Maikeru simply smiled in response, bringing up his fist into an aggressive combat stance. As he did so, the spirit of his blade, Susano, manifested behind him. A large blue armored samurai, with a grizzly looking chipped blade, the handle of which was wrapped in long flowing bandages. This brought out a low whistle from the girl as she dropped into her own combat stance, maybe this fight would be more interesting than she had anticipated.

Hopping on her feet, the girl jumped into her own combat stance, more agile and dextrous than her opponents. As she hopped up and down, the balls of her feet making contact with each leap, keeping her as mobile as possible, she began to move. Flicking her wrist as she came towards the Uchiha to draw out a kunai in each hand. There was a brief moment of pause in the battle, perceivable to only the opponents. A moment where they eyed each other up, looking for weaknesses to exploit and weak points on their body to abuse.

Maikeru’s Sharingan willed into life, the tomoe spinning before settling in their final place around his pupil. He saw the girl’s movements with heightened clarity, each movement of her limbs appearing to him moments before the girl actually made them. There was one final smile from each combatant before their first contact began.

The girl brought her kunai down in a wide over hand arc, aiming for the neck of the Uchiha, drawing out a side step from the boy, before countering with a quick jab aimed at her rib cage. As the boy moved his spirit mimicked the movements, it’s blade coming down in a wide arc at the girl. Rolling on her feet she moved to the left, avoiding the counter, and getting closer to limit her opponent's range of motion.

She was smaller than the boy in front of her, which she knew she needed to use to her advantage. As she rolled she planted her lead foot inside of Maikeru’s guard, flipping the kunai in her palm in order to bring it into an upward slash aimed at his chest. Reacting quickly he brought his corrupted right arm up to block as he brought his lead foot back, the blade bounced harmlessly off the stone like limb, but, it gave the girl momentum. She dug in, dropping the kunai to quickly weave one-handed seals in the boy’s face.

His Sharingan spun wildly as it analyzed the jutsu being cast, his eyes widening as the realization dawned on him. A spark of lightning erupted from her palm, before being shot forward towards the unexpecting boy. With little time to counter, he did what only came natural to him. From his stomach, the sealing matrix containing the power of his spirit unraveled, sending dark black lines all across the exposed parts of his body, up to his chin.

He jumped backwards, his body convulsing from the burst of electricity that ravaged through his muscular system. Taking a moment, he ran his tongue along the enlarged canines in his mouth, a thoughtful expression on his face.

‘So… the mark of the king does interact with my cursed seal, fascinating.’ He thought to himself, before bringing his fist up again. Perhaps it was time to stop going easy.

Around him invisible energy started to leak from the cursed seal, the particles infecting and ravaging the body of his opponent. Her limbs started to feel heavy, her muscles refused to react the way she commanded them, like invisible spider threads holding and weighing her down. Licking his lips maliciously, the boy’s eyes evolved once again, forming into the Mangekyo Sharingan of his clan.

“Let’s begin, shall we?” He asked, a wicked smile coming onto his face.

The cursed right arm of his body began to glow, the blue gem-like qualities creating an ethereal light from them as one of the many augments he had crafted released their sealing matrix. Disappearing in a flash of blue electricity, he appeared in front of the girl, his hand glowing with cursed energy.

“Shit shit shit!” she muttered before feeling the weight of his fist lock into her stomach, causing her to double over. When the hell did medics learn to fight?

Pushing his own momentum this time, Maikeru followed up. He brought his foot up in a vicious kicked aimed at the girl’s head, disorienting her and buying him time. Rapidly running through hand seals, he eventually landed on the tiger sign before jumping backwards.

“Sol fire tempest!” he roared, summoning three large meteors from the sky.

Adrenaline filled his blood as the cursed seal finally kicked in, giving his already enhanced clarity and precognition even greater visual prowess. Kicking off from his landing position, he was already working on his next move, watching as the girl did her best to dodge the large celestial bodies he had summoned forth.

As she jumped around, dodging explosion after explosion, Maikeru intercepted her path, his eyes spinning as they met with hers.

“Tsukuyomi!” He muttered, the genjutsu landing it’s effects on the girl.

As she cried and screamed, the tortures of her own psyche damaging her, Maikeru just watched with a coldness in his eyes unlike him. If he were more aware of himself he would be disgusted, he would question what he had truly become, but, there was none of that. He simply watched as the girl fell to her knees, before falling to the mental assault.

Grimacing, Maikeru knelt down, placing a hand on her stomach before crafting his own one-handed seals. The green glow the emanated from his palm radiated through her body, causing her breathing to become apparent and more steady.

“Good.. can’t have you dying on me..” He said simply, before turning and exiting the colliseum. He had a bigger fish to fry.
